Abstract

The radical addition of perfluorohexyl iodide to vinyl acetate to give an iodine-containing adduct has been studied under different conditions in order to define their influence on the reaction. Experiments have been carried out varying parameters (molar ratio of reagents, weight percent of initiator, reaction time, temperature, oxygen removal) and studying the effects on the perfluoroalkyl iodide conversion and on the adduct yield. From the experimental data obtained, the conditions required to optimize the adduct yield have been defined.
